I've been wanting to make my own laundry detergent for a while now, but I couldn't find washing soda in any store around me to save my life.  I broke down last week, after being reminded of how awesome this would be to my family, environment, and wallet, and ordered some on amazon.  It came in the mail today and I couldn't wait to get started!


The first thing I had to do was grate the my Fels-Naptha laundry bar.


This was the most time consuming part.  Next I added 1 cup each of borax and washing soda.  Mix all of your ingredients together and VOILA your own laundry detergent!  There is a recipe for liquid laundry detergent, but it's larger volume that you would need to store and it's much more involved.  This method is more simple which is what I prefer.  I was so anxious when I finished that I washed a load!
